Campus Kitchen at UGA hosts Food Waste Fiasco

On August 8, the Campus Kitchen at UGA kicked off the school year with the “Food Waste Fiasco” event in the Memorial Hall Ballroom. The event featured Rob Greenfield, a nationally known dumpster diver and sustainability activist. Over 120 attendees experienced food recovery first-hand by enjoying a fresh meal prepared by Campus Kitchen at UGA from donated grocery store and farmer’s market surplus.

The event provided participants the opportunity to hear how Athens addresses food waste and food insecurity through food donations to nonprofits, composting, and recycling. Featured speakers included Campus Kitchen at UGA, Athens Community Council on Aging, Action INC., UGA Food Services, Let Us Compost, UGArden, and ACC Solid Waste Dept. This is event was sponsored in part by the David and Evelyn Knauft Endowment for Service-Learning.
